Afternoon update on our snowstorm potential for this weekend.
No real trend today with model guidance. It looks to me like a two part storm. The first part being the ULL (Upper level low) which is the main energy diving down. This alone will likely produce accumulating snow for someone. The second part is the development of a coastal low. This will likely happen, but how close to the coastline will it happen? If it's close, this event has high end potential. Some of these outrageous totals being thrown around by individual model runs can't be totally ruled out. If it's to far away, then snow will be confined to the immediate coastline. It could be too far East altogether.
Below is the 12z Euro & EPS. I think it does a great job showing ULL action & coastal low action. You can see in the Carolinas how snow extends back West then you can see an enhancement of snow along the coast. That's the coastal low cranking up at the last minute. This is NOT forecast snow totals. This just shows a possible scenario. But to me with what we are seeing, it's a realistic scenario & I think highlights the two section part of this system well.
As always, expect wild shifts. But the "boom" potential with this is high.. Very high.
